This is a color schematic titled "The Ranger Station" showing how to plumb and wire an onboard air (OBA) compressor system in a vehicle. The diagram depicts an engine-driven compressor feeding air through a one-way check valve into a 2.5 gallon air tank. The tank is fitted with a regulator with a 0-160 PSI pressure gauge, a 50-200 PSI safety valve, and lines running to two quick-connect fittings (front and rear). On the electrical side, a 0-160 PSI pressure switch mounted off the tank works with a toggle switch to control a 12-volt relay (with terminals labeled L, S, B). The relay switches power from the battery to the compressor clutch, with a green control wire running to the compressor and circuit protection routed through the vehicle's fuse panel. Air lines are shown in red/brown and yellow, and wiring in orange, red, black, and green.
